Kakadda Population - West Nimar, Madhya Pradesh

Kakadda is a medium size village located in Maheshwar Tehsil of West Nimar district, Madhya Pradesh with total 371 families residing. The Kakadda village has population of 1842 of which 944 are males while 898 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kakadda village population of children with age 0-6 is 247 which makes up 13.41 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kakadda village is 951 which is higher than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Kakadda as per census is 1058, higher than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Kakadda village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Kakadda village was 68.59 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Kakadda Male literacy stands at 79.00 % while female literacy rate was 57.46 %.

Caste Factor

Kakadda village of West Nimar has substantial population of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 28.99 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 9.07 % of total population in Kakadda village.

Work Profile

In Kakadda village out of total population, 833 were engaged in work activities. 62.55 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 37.45 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 833 workers engaged in Main Work, 20 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 50 were Agricultural labourer.
